2008-09-17 5 views
0

대시 보드 애플리케이션으로 사용할 수있는 사용자 정의 가능한 프레임 워크를 제공하는 DotNetNuke, Eclipse, Websphere 등과 같은 애플리케이션 프레임 워크가 현재 제공됩니다. 당신은 이것을 사용합니까, 아니면 당신과 당신의 동료들은 당신이 스스로 지탱 해주는 놀랍고, 모듈화되고, 유지 보수가 가능한 대시 보드 프레임 워크를 계속 쓰고 있습니까?응용 프로그램 프레임 워크를 사용합니까?

거기에 자체적 인 엔터프라이즈 클래스 인프라를 구축하는 데 사용할 수있는 OS 독립적 프레임 워크가 있습니까?

+0

Eclipse는 프레임 워크가 아니라 IDE입니다. 하지만, 모든 것을하기 위해 노력하고 있기 때문에, 나는 뭔가를 간과 할 수도 있습니다.) – Thomas

+0

우리는 단지 토론 된 것이 아니라 대답 할 수있는 질문을 선호합니다. –

답변

1

Oracle Application Development Framework를 사용하고 있습니다. 완벽하게 지원되는 프레임 워크이며 오라클은 자체 엔터프라이즈 애플리케이션을 구축하기 위해이 프레임 워크를 사용합니다. 기본 데이터 객체에 매우 쉽게 바인딩 할 수있는 많은 JSF 구성 요소가 제공됩니다. 데이터베이스 데이터가 필요한 모든 Java 응용 프로그램에이를 권장합니다.

당신은 오라클 위키에 대한 논의를 찾을 수 : http://wiki.oracle.com/page/ADF+Methodology+-+Work+in+Progressent

1

아무도 정답이 없습니다. 비즈니스 요구 사항을 살펴보십시오. 일반적인 작업을 수행하는 경우 확립 된 프레임 워크에서 시작하는 것이 좋습니다. 일부 맞춤 구성 요소 또는 위젯이 필요하다고 생각되면 사내에서 보유한 지식과 기술을 사용하여 확장 가능한 프레임 워크를 찾으십시오.

응용 프로그램 프레임 워크 또는 대시 보드를 만드는 것이 업무를 제외하고 완전히 새로운 프레임 워크 또는 대시 보드를 만들기 전에 매우 열심히보아야합니다.

0

직장에서 우리는 가능한 한 처음부터 창조하려고 노력합니다. 우리는 Frameworks를 많이 사용합니다 (끝 프레임 워크에서 항상 끝나는 것은 아닙니다). 우리는 Dot Net Nuke를 많이 사용했습니다. 우리가 많이 사용하는 다른 프레임 워크는 CSLA입니다.

0

개인적으로 DotNetNuke를 개인 및 비즈니스 관련 벤처 기업에 광범위하게 사용합니다. 그러나 .NET 솔루션이므로 Windows에 따라 DNN이 요구 사항 중 하나를 충족하지 못합니다.

DotNetNuke를 사용하면 배송 시간이 크게 단축되었으며 일반적인 부품을 구현하는 것이 아니라 핵심 요구 사항에 집중할 수 있음을 발견했습니다.

0

프레임 워크의 확장 성을 신중하게 고려해야합니다. 밖에있는 프레임 워크가 있습니다. 데이터베이스를 망치는 것만 큼 좋지는 않지만 영광스러운 파일 시스템이라고 생각하기 때문입니다. 이러한 프레임 워크는 전혀 확장되지 않습니다.

관련 문제